In today’s episode of The Alignment Table, Sharon Preston opens a powerful conversation about The Invisible Saboteur - the quiet identity patterns that limit even the most accomplished women in leadership.
This isn’t fear. It isn’t imposter syndrome. It is something deeper and more nuanced: the outdated identity running your decisions long after you have outgrown it.
Sharon explores how this internal saboteur shows up through delayed decisions, diluted authority, overfunctioning, carrying emotional labour, and underplaying your voice in rooms where you should lead.
You will learn how identity shapes behaviour, behaviour shapes environment, and environment shapes results, the human algorithm behind aligned leadership.
You will also hear how invisible saboteurs impact team culture, leadership confidence, and the organisation’s performance, and why intentional identity upgrades are essential for women navigating senior roles in tech, luxury, and corporate leadership.
This episode blends psychology, leadership strategy, emotional intelligence, and nervous system regulation, offering depth, insight, and practical steps for women entering their next era of clarity, confidence, and calm authority.
